The Warriors picked up the win in their final regular-season game at Oracle Arena.

Kevin Durant added 16 points and seven assists, making six of seven field goals, as the Warriors players opted to honour the past by sporting throwback white "We Believe" jerseys worn during the 2007 playoff run that snapped a 12-year post-season drought.

"Let me just say that for 47 years, Warriors fans have stuck with us through thick and thin," coach Steve Kerr told fans moments after the final buzzer, also thanking the arena staff. "Let’s be honest, most of those years have been a little thin." Draymond Green just missed a triple-double with 10 points, 10 rebounds and nine assists in Golden State’s seventh win over the last eight games and fifth in a row at home. DeMarcus Cousins contributed 12 points, nine boards and four assists playing with foul trouble.

"Are they not going to make the playoffs?" Clippers coach Doc Rivers quipped. "I hope they don’t make it. That would be phenomenal. I’m just saying, it would be."Golden State made 10 of its first 13 shots — Durant hitting his initial four and Curry starting 3 for 3. Curry wound up just 3 for 10 from deep.The Warriors played their 1,936th regular-season game at Oracle, where the first game was held on Oct. 24, 1967, against Cincinnati.
